I was told it was something that Greek and Roman patrician families had! Actually it stems from this..... The ancient Greeks venerated a long second toe as the ideal of physical perfection. You can still see these long toes on ancient Greek and Roman statues. The Vikings believed that a long second toe meant you’d have a long life. Better not tell Jan that she is perfect.
